Web14 Apr 2024 · Preheat your air fryer to 200C/400F and lightly grease the air fryer basket. Step 2: Season the salmon Next, add the salmon and olive oil into a small bowl and mix. Add the salt, pepper, and spices, and rub them onto the fish. Ensure all sides of the fish are seasoned. Step 3- Air fry the salmon WebAir Fry: Place the breaded salmon in the air fryer basket in a single layer. Using the oil sprayer, spritz the salmon and cook to 400ºF for 8 minutes on each side or until an internal temperature reaches 145ºF in the thickest part of the salmon filet. Carefully remove the salmon from the air fryer basket and serve.

Web3 Apr 2024 · The temperature and time needed to cook salmon in an air fryer will depend on the size and thickness of the fish. Generally, you should set the air fryer to 375-400°F and cook the salmon for 8-10 minutes.
